American Metalcraft 12-Inch Round Onyx Galvanized Wide Rim Serving Pan/Tray

3/8 Inch High, 6 mm Thick

This 12-inch round serving pan combines a bold onyx galvanized finish with a sturdy wide-rim design for eye-catching tabletop presentation.

  • 12-inch round serving pan/tray for stylish tabletop presentation.
  • Dark galvanized construction with an onyx finish for a distinctive look.
  • Wide-rim design helps frame plated food and enhance presentation.
  • Low 3/8-inch profile with 6 mm thickness for a sturdy feel.
  • Suitable for serving items ranging from pizza to burritos.
  • Part of a matching wide-rim pan collection with multiple sizes.
